Output 792da505078c63c1360eea2357643bf0989fbdb2bb709fcd35ee17aa344233bd:128

value
159469
script pubkey
OP_0 OP_PUSHBYTES_20 e121ea4e2c426ae7d356e7c4ea2a158a1c564450
address
bc1quys75n3vgf4w056kulzw52s43gw9v3zs650rpk
transaction
792da505078c63c1360eea2357643bf0989fbdb2bb709fcd35ee17aa344233bd
confirmations
216438
spent
true